How can I make a middle column in my sprint board burn down stories and effect the burndown chart?

Andrew Arizpe November 16, 2017

On my sprint board, I want a custom middle column "Done in Dev" to burn down stories and effect the burndown chart when a story is placed in it. I cannot find a way to make any column, other than the far right column, do this. Is there a way? If not has atlassian explained why?

It hasn't changed - "done" is when you burn down, and that is the last column on the board.  You need to match your definition of done into the last column.  If "done" is "dev done, but not QA or deployed", then put "dev done" in the last column, along with QA and deployed.  Or even drop QA and Deployed from the board completely, as they're not relevant to the team's "done".

No, you can't.

The right hand column is "done".  Nothing else is. 

There is a good argument for saying "the x right hand columns are 'done'" and another good argument for the ability to use the left hand column(s) the "done" area, but not an arbitrary one in the middle.  The whole point of a board is things move across it in one direction, until they reach "done"
